What is a Crypto Casino?
A crypto casino is an online gaming platform that accepts cryptocurrencies-- such as Bitcoin (BTC), Ethereum (ETH), Litecoin (LTC), or Tether (GBPT)-- as a primary approach for deposits, withdrawals, and gameplay. Unlike traditional operators that run through centralized banking systems, crypto gambling establishments utilize decentralized journals to process transactions, typically resulting in near-instant transfers and lower charges.
These platforms usually fall under 2 categories:
- Hybrid Casinos: Sites that accept both standard fiat currencies and cryptocurrencies.
- Crypto Casino's-Native Casinos: Platforms built specifically for blockchain deals, frequently including anonymous registration and specialized "provably fair" video games.
Why Players Are Switching to Crypto
The shift towards crypto betting is driven by numerous unique benefits that standard brick-and-mortar or basic online casinos struggle to match.
1. Boosted Privacy and Anonymity
Conventional gambling establishments are bound by "Know Your Customer" (KYC) regulations that require substantial documents, such as energy costs and image IDs. Lots of crypto casinos, nevertheless, permit "no-KYC" sign-ups, where users just require an e-mail address to start wagering. This provides a higher degree of personal privacy for those who choose to keep their monetary life different from their gaming practices.
2. Deal Speed
Bank transfers can take up to 5 business days to clear, and credit card payments are frequently flagged or obstructed by monetary organizations. Crypto transactions are processed on the blockchain, generally clearing in minutes, no matter the time of day or the user's area.
3. Worldwide Accessibility
Lots of countries have stringent guidelines or banking blocks versus online gambling. Cryptocurrency operates on a borderless network, permitting users in limited jurisdictions to gain access to platforms that they otherwise would not be able to reach through standard banking channels.
4. Provably Fair Gameplay
This is perhaps the most significant technological development in the sector. "Provably fair" algorithms enable gamers to verify the randomness and fairness of every bet using cryptographic hashes. Instead of trusting a casino's word that their random number generator (RNG) is unbiased, players can separately audit the outcomes.

The Role of Smart Contracts in Gaming
Looking ahead, the combination of smart contracts is set to further reinvent the market. A wise contract is a self-executing agreement with the regards to the agreement straight written into code.
In a casino setting, this means that payments can be automated. When a player wins a hand or strikes a prize, the wise contract automatically carries out the deal to the player's wallet without human intervention. This gets rid of the threat of a casino withholding profits or experiencing "technical delays" throughout the payout process.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)Are crypto casinos legal?
The legality of crypto gambling establishments depends upon your jurisdiction. Some nations have legalized and regulated them, others have actually prohibited them totally, and many remain in a "grey location." Always inspect your regional laws before engaging with these platforms.
Are my earnings taxable?
In lots of jurisdictions, cryptocurrency is dealt with as a possession. Any gains understood from gambling might go through capital gains or income tax. It is the player's responsibility to track their wins and losses for tax reporting purposes.
Can I lose my money if the crypto market crashes?
Yes. If you hold your jackpots in a volatile cryptocurrency (like BTC or ETH) rather of a stablecoin (like GBPT or GBPC), the worth of your bankroll can fluctuate based upon market conditions.
What is a "Provably Fair" game?
A provably fair video game provides the gamer with a "seed" or cryptographic hash before the round begins. After the round, the player can use this hash to mathematically verify that the outcome was predetermined and that the casino did not alter the lead to real-time.
Are crypto gambling establishments safer than standard ones?
They can be much safer concerning deal openness and payment speed, but they also require the user to be their own "bank." If you lose your password or send coins to the wrong address, assistance may not be able to recuperate your funds.
